Sound and image come from the same system, performed live. The same system has three stage set-ups and a fourth with no operator: the installation, which runs on its own for hours or days.
| Format | Solo audiovisual performance |
|---|---|
| Duration | 30 / 45 / 60 min |
| Timings | Setup 45 min · soundcheck 30 min · breakdown 20 min |
| Audio (venue) | Stereo PA suited to the space · 2 DI channels or balanced output from the artist’s interface · 2 stage monitors or stereo return · desk with 2 free channels |
| Video (venue) | Projection min. 5,000 lm in a dark room, or LED wall · HDMI input at the artist position with cable to the table · 1920×1080 at 60 fps · single screen preferred (other formats with 15 days notice) |
| Power and table | Table 1.5 × 0.8 m, stable, standing height · 4 grounded outlets on the audio phase · low spot light on the table, never front light on the artist |
| Artist provides | Computer, audio interface, controllers, synthesizers and own electronics · cables to the connection point |

Set versions
| CLUB / FESTIVAL 45–60 min | Dancefloor, dark room, large PA. A present rhythmic pulse, rising density, peaks of collapse. Image on a large screen behind. PA · Projeção / LED · Pista |
|---|---|
| CONCERTO / INSTITUIÇÃO 30–40 min | Seated audience, treated room. Slower, more dynamic, silence as material. Focus on the image. Can end with a 5-minute talk. Sala tratada · Projeção grande |
| TECH EVENT / ABERTURA 15–25 min | Standing audience, ambient light, divided attention. More direct, with a live demonstration of the system: showing the code and what a parameter change does. Tela · Som estéreo |
